The Story of Jazabella
This name arrived in the 2010s, a harmonious blend of modern zest and classic devotion.
Jazabella is a contemporary name, a luminous combination of the energetic 'Jaz-' prefix and the widely cherished name Isabella, of Italian and Hebrew origin, meaning 'pledged to God.' This fusion creates a name that feels both spirited and deeply meaningful.
